- 浏览: 187715 次
- 性别:
- 来自: 海口
最新评论
-
cloud.hy:
marked
ExtJs中TextField与TextArea的只读属性设置 -
y711:
但是,你后来有没有想过,为什么会出现这种差异?是应用系统的程序 ...
jboss4.0.5使用JDK1.6出现的问题 -
ccxw1983:
...
EJB与JavaBean之区别 -
diaolanshan:
这个是何解啊?
JBOSS中java out of memory的解决方法 -
zhuqx1130:
oracle的常用命令
相关推荐
### Oracle权限函数详解 在Oracle数据库管理中,权限管理是一项重要的任务,它涉及到对用户、角色及对象等数据库实体的访问控制。通过合理地分配权限,可以有效地保护数据的安全性和完整性,同时确保业务流程的正常...
详细介绍了oracle的建表语句 增删改查 内外连接查询 授权用户 建sequence oracle常用内置函数 ddl语句 事务控制语句 tcl 等
Oracle 和 SQL Server 是两种常用的数据库管理系统,它们都提供了丰富的函数来处理数据。下面将详细介绍这两个系统中的部分关键函数命令。 1. **绝对值**:在 Oracle 和 SQL Server 中,`ABS()` 函数用于计算数值的...
### Oracle存储过程、函数和包的关键知识点 #### 1. 存储过程和函数的认识 - **定义**:存储过程和函数是特定类型的PL/SQL块,它们被存储在数据库中,作为命名的对象存在。 - **命名存储**:与普通的PL/SQL块不同,...
5. **授权与测试**: 授予新用户必要的权限,如`CONNECT`,`RESOURCE`,以及`EXP_FULL_DATABASE`和`IMP_FULL_DATABASE`等。然后,测试密码更新过程。尝试使用一个简单的字符串,如`123456`,这应该会失败,因为我们...
`Ora 10G SQL Reference.chm`是Oracle 10g的SQL参考手册,其中包含了详细的SQL语法、函数、操作符和数据库管理命令。当遇到权限问题时,可以查阅此手册获取关于`GRANT`、`REVOKE`、`ALTER USER`和`SET ROLE`等命令...
在Oracle数据库管理中,创建基础数据表、函数与存储过程是构建复杂应用系统的基础步骤。以下将基于给定文件中的信息,深入解析如何在Oracle环境下进行这些操作。 ### 创建用户 首先,创建用户是进行数据库操作的...
文本文档中的“Oracle函数大全”涵盖了Oracle数据库提供的大量内置函数,包括数学函数、字符串函数、日期时间函数、转换函数等。熟悉这些函数的用法,能有效提升SQL查询和程序编写效率。 通过本次“Oracle数据库...
WM_CONCAT是一个非标准的Oracle函数,它能将多个字符串合并成一个单一的字符串,用分隔符(默认为逗号)连接。这个函数在早期的Oracle版本中很常用,但在11g及更高版本中被DEPRECATED,推荐使用SQL标准的CONCAT函数...
is_grant => TRUE, -- 授权还是取消授权 privilege => 'connect', -- 连接权限 start_date => NULL, -- 起始日期,不维护则为不限制 end_date => NULL -- 结束日期 ); END; ``` 2. **增加 resolve 权限**:在...
7. **权限和角色**:Oracle提供了精细的权限系统,允许管理员对用户进行授权,控制他们对数据库资源的访问。角色是权限的集合,可以方便地分配和管理大量权限。通过GRANT和REVOKE语句,可以实现权限的授予和撤销。 ...
散列分区通过在分区键上执行散列函数来决定存储的分区,目的是将数据尽可能均匀地分布到各个分区中,减少磁盘I/O争用的可能性。 示例SQL如下: ```sql CREATE TABLE EMPLOYEE ( EMPNO NUMBER(2), EMP_NAME ...
如果在执行过程中遇到任何异常,如权限错误或语法错误,`DBMS_OUTPUT.PUT_LINE`函数会捕获并打印出错误信息。 ```sql BEGIN EXECUTE IMMEDIATE 'grant select on ' || rec.object_name || ' to ' || p_grantee; ...
在Oracle数据库管理中,权限管理和授予是非常重要的一个环节。它确保了数据的安全性和访问控制的有效性。然而,在进行权限授予时可能会遇到各种各样的错误,其中`ORA-01720`就是一个典型的例子。该错误提示“授权...
然而,为了保护代码安全,Oracle允许开发者对存储过程、函数等PL/SQL对象进行加密。这在某些情况下可能会给维护和协作带来困扰,因为无法直接查看源代码。这时,“Oracle反编译工具”就显得尤为重要。 “Oracle反...
在处理日期时,应避免依赖默认格式,使用TO_DATE函数将字符串转换为日期,同时指定日期格式,以防止歧义。例如,插入日期时,最好使用如`to_date('01/02/2003', 'DD/MM/YYYY')`这样的格式。 对于时间单位的操作,...
在Oracle数据库中,"wrapped"代码是指经过编译和加密的存储过程、函数或包,通常用于保护敏感的商业逻辑或源代码不被未经授权的访问。这个工具在Oracle 10g、11g和12c版本中均通过了测试,确保了广泛的兼容性,并且...
在创建包规范时,我们需要定义包的名称、授权、过程和函数。例如,创建一个名为`PKG_ORDERS`的包,用于处理订单操作,其规范可能如下: ```sql CREATE OR REPLACE PACKAGE PKG_ORDERS AS -- 声明公共变量 l_order...
在Oracle数据库中,触发器是一种特殊类型的存储过程,它会在特定的数据库操作(如INSERT、UPDATE或DELETE)发生时自动执行。在这个场景中,我们关注的是一个特定的触发器,它在插入数据后被调用,并通过存储过程来...